Output 2644debea04b1285486ee588cd7691580bda943bb6245aa1b9df9d7ca7955368:0

value
4612897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5ae92beb9508ef26fdf4a3ff0207371eb01903 OP_EQUAL
address
32pLwSWgoRWwHauvj3B83BrJYXDRDU8Lca
transaction
2644debea04b1285486ee588cd7691580bda943bb6245aa1b9df9d7ca7955368
spent
true